About This Role

Applying machine learning to analyze camera trap images, acoustic recordings, and tracking data for conservation.

A Day in the Life

A Wildlife Data Scientist spends their day collecting, cleaning, and analyzing large datasets from various sources like camera traps, acoustic sensors, and GPS trackers. They develop machine learning models to identify species, track movements, and predict ecological patterns, ultimately informing conservation strategies.

  • Develop and implement machine learning models for image and acoustic data analysis (e.g., species identification)
  • Process and clean large datasets from camera traps, GPS collars, and environmental sensors
  • Design and optimize algorithms for wildlife tracking and behavioral analysis
  • Collaborate with wildlife biologists to understand research questions and data needs
  • Visualize complex ecological data to communicate insights effectively
  • Write code in Python or R for data manipulation, analysis, and model development
  • Contribute to scientific publications and technical reports
  • Stay updated with the latest advancements in AI, machine learning, and conservation technology

Salary in Sri Lanka (LKR / month)

Entry LevelRs.70k – Rs.100k/mo
Mid-LevelRs.150k – Rs.280k/mo
SeniorRs.300k – Rs.700k/mo
Entry: Junior Wildlife Data AnalystMid: Wildlife Data ScientistSenior: Lead Wildlife Data Scientist / Principal AI for Conservation Researcher

Typical progression: 3yr to mid · 8yr to senior

Starting with data cleaning and basic analysis, one progresses to developing complex machine learning models, leading data science projects, and potentially managing a team of data scientists focused on conservation.

Market Outlook

GROWING

This is an emerging field in Sri Lanka, with growing interest from conservation organizations and universities looking to leverage technology for more efficient wildlife monitoring and research.

Hiring: LOW

University Research DepartmentsDepartment of Wildlife Conservation (emerging)IUCN Sri Lanka (project-based)Tech companies with CSR in conservation

GROWING

Globally, the demand for data scientists with domain expertise in conservation is rapidly increasing as technology plays a larger role in environmental monitoring and protection.
